Design features of the system on Nissan Juke

Optical cleaning system on the model Nissan Juke integrated into the front bumper and works synchronously with the activation of the windshield washer when the low beam is on. The main element here is solenoid valve, which meters the supply of liquid from the main tank. Unlike some other cars, where the headlight pumps may be separate, this one often uses a common pump with a branched line.

The injectors are installed at the bottom of the bumper and have a lifting mechanism that is activated by hydraulic pressure. This complex device is susceptible to freezing of residual water in winter. If you did not drain the fluid before the onset of cold weather, mechanism springs may become deformed and plastic parts may crack due to ice. This is why it is important to use only anti-freeze liquid all year round.

Supply lines in Nissan Juke laid along a complex route: from the tank through the fender liners to the bumper. A long pipe route increases the risk of damage when repairing the suspension or replacing rims. Often, owners do not even suspect that the problem lies not in the pump, but in a pinched hose or a disconnected quick-release connection under the arch.

The main reasons for headlight washer failure

The most common reason for a washer not working is failure fluid pump. It may simply burn out due to natural wear of the brushes or jam due to contamination of the fluid. Owners Nissan Juke They often notice that when they try to turn on the headlight washers, the relay clicks, but there is no sound of the motor operating. This is a sure sign that the electrical circuit is closed and the mechanical part has failed.

The second most common problem is clogging washer nozzles. Dust, dirt and insect debris clog the thin channels through which the high-pressure jet is delivered. Even if the pump is working properly, the pressure will not be enough to lift the nozzle mechanism and spray the liquid. In this case, the stream may flow in drops or not come out at all.

Often there is a situation with rupture or chafing supply hoses. Over time, plastic hardens and loses elasticity, especially in the bends of the wheel arches. When driving on a bad road, vibration can cause the hose to burst and the fluid will pour directly into the fender liner, creating the feeling that the pump is running, but the headlights are not being washed.

Electrical faults also play a role. Oxidation of connectors, a blown fuse, or a malfunctioning body control module (BCM) can completely shut down the system. Switching relay often located in the fuse box under the hood and can oxidize if exposed to moisture.

DIY fault diagnosis

Before you run to the store for new spare parts, you need to conduct a thorough diagnosis. First of all, check the fluid level in the reservoir. If it is full, try turning on the windshield washer. If it works, then the general pump is working properly, and the problem is localized in the line leading to the headlights, or in the separating valve.

If neither the glass nor the headlights wash, check the fuse. On Nissan Juke it is usually designated as WASHER or FH in the fuse box under the hood. Use a multimeter to check continuity, or simply replace the fuse with a known good fuse. Often the problem is solved by replacing the part for 100 rubles.

Then you need to check the electrical signal at the pump or injector connector. Remove the connector and have an assistant turn on the washer. If there is voltage, then the problem is in the actuator itself. If there is no voltage, look for a break in the wiring or a faulty relay. In some cases, checking helps grounding pump housing.

A visual inspection of the engine compartment and wheel arches may reveal obvious damage to the hoses. Inspect the connections for leaks. If you see wet spots on the fender liners or splashes on the inside of the bumper, it means there is depressurization systems. This requires dismantling the elements to find the exact location of the leak.

Pay special attention to the injector lifting mechanism. Try pressing them gently with your finger (with the ignition off) to make sure they are not mechanically jammed. Ice, dirt or a broken spring may block movement. If the mechanism jams, the jet will not be able to rise to the headlight glass, even with pressure.

Step-by-step instructions for replacement and repair

First, prepare the necessary tools: a set of screwdrivers, 10 and 12 wrenches, pliers, a new pump or injectors, and sealant. If you plan to change hoses, stock up on clamps and pieces of pipe of suitable diameter. Before starting work, be sure to turn off negative terminal battery to avoid short circuit when working with wiring.

Removing the front bumper Nissan Juke - a labor-intensive process, but often necessary for access to highways. Remove the screws in the wheel arches and under the radiator grille. Carefully unclip the perimeter latches. Be extremely careful with plastic clips, as they are very fragile in the cold. After removing the bumper you will have direct access to all system components.

The pump is replaced as follows: drain the liquid, disconnect the wiring connectors and hoses. Remove the old pump from the reservoir. Install the new one, making sure the sealing ring is tight. Connect hoses and wires. If you are changing injectors, it is easiest to remove them together with the supply pipe, so as not to damage the fragile lifting mechanism when removing it.

When replacing hoses, make sure the new tubes have the same inside diameter. Use special quick-release connectors if they are provided for in the design. Do not overtighten the clamps to avoid pinching the tube. Route the hoses so that they do not touch sharp edges of the body or come into contact with rotating parts of the suspension.

After installing all parts, reassemble. Make sure all connectors are securely locked until they click into place. Before installing the bumper in place, check the operation of the system without completely removing it. If everything works, secure the bumper and check the spray angle. The jet should hit the headlight glass exactly, without splashing around.
